When there is too much detail in your artwork or your design has tints and tones with graduating colours then silkscreen printing or offset printing is the best option for your badge.


For solid colours we will silkscreen print the badge at 300dpi, and pantone match colours. For artwork that has tints or graduating colours, we will offset print using CMYK colours.


An epoxy coating is applied to your badge to protect the printing. Another popular choice for large campaigns.


The offset printing process offers full-colour reproduction with outstanding details and accuracy.
